1) Scan and Shortlist

  • Start with a universe: your watchlist, sector leaders, or earnings names
  • Use AI summaries to highlight unusual IV changes, skew shifts, or signal factors
  • Shortlist 3–5 tickers where implied vs. realized volatility is meaningfully dislocated

2) Form a Thesis

  • Assess catalysts: earnings timing, macro events, seasonal tendencies
  • Align with volatility regime: trending high IV (sell premium cautiously) vs. compressed IV (consider long vega)
  • Translate into a directionless, bullish, or bearish stance

3) Match Strategy to Thesis

  • Bullish with moderate IV: debit call spread or calendar
  • Bearish with high skew: bear put spread or ratio put spread (with risk controls)
  • Neutral with elevated IV: iron condor or short strangle (defined-risk preferred)

4) Quantify Risk

  • Review Greeks and P/L across price and volatility shifts
  • Set max loss thresholds and position sizing rules (e.g., 1–2% of portfolio at risk)
  • Note event risk: adjust expiries or define risk around catalysts

5) Execute and Monitor

  • Place orders with realistic fills based on liquidity cues
  • Enable alerts for IV crush, delta drift, or breached breakevens
  • Journal the thesis and outcome to refine your playbook

Practical Examples: 3 Common Use Cases

Use these examples as templates. They're educational, not financial advice.

1) Trading an Earnings Volatility Crush

  • Setup: IV elevated into earnings; you expect a typical post-release crush
  • Strategy: Sell a defined-risk credit spread (e.g., call spread above expected move) or an iron condor around expected move
  • AI Assist: Compare historical IV crush magnitude, simulate P/L with ±1–2 standard deviation price moves, and stress-test for gap risk

2) Hedging a Concentrated Equity Position

  • Setup: Large unrealized gains in a single name; nervous about downside into year-end
  • Strategy: Protective put or a collar (long put, short call) to reduce net cost
  • AI Assist: Optimize strike selection based on skew, examine net portfolio delta/vega, and project hedge effectiveness under different vol regimes

3) Generating Income in a Sideways Market

  • Setup: Range-bound underlying; IV moderately high
  • Strategy: Iron condor with wide wings, staggered expiries to diversify event risk
  • AI Assist: Identify ranges with high probability of expiring worthless, model theta decay curves, and set alerts for early management

Limits to Respect: Use AI, Don't Outsource Judgment

No tool—not even the best AI—is a crystal ball. Keep these guardrails in place:

  • Garbage in, garbage out: Ensure your inputs (thesis, constraints) are thoughtful
  • Data latency and liquidity: Price snapshots change; use realistic fill assumptions
  • Overfitting risk: Don't anchor to one backtest; stress across regimes
  • Compliance and suitability: Align with your risk tolerance and any professional requirements

A disciplined process plus AI assistance beats gut feel alone—but you're still the risk manager.
